Last Utterance

Also give me a river with cool continuous flowing water
I will swim in the water and in the moon light
I’ll touch the blue sky and become green, drink
Black cloud and become a vast waterbed, I’ll break
The full moon into pieces with the hammer and
Build a palace on the sand shoal. In the midnight
When the sand bank will wake up in bright light
As if a bride wakes up with the melody of sehnai
The walls of marriage-house illuminates with fireworks
I’ll also bathe with the springs of melody and light
With clasped hands I begged for my life
Human life is dearer to human being itself
Still they didn’t listen to me, they bounded my hands
And legs with metal chain and said, last destination
For the sinners are oven of fire and God has allotted
Haviah Dozokh, this function is arranged to enjoy
Your results. This celebration in only for you
But I saw those who threw me in the fire were not humans
Just like donkey they resembled, they shouted with
Their eyes and ears, sub-humans like Pariah dogs
Burning down into ashes, I was reciting sacred scriptures
Of Allah, at this time a gusty wind is flying away all the ashes
Of the oven and I felt that vitality of a life is so tine a dot
Even a tree can live longer that human beings . . .
If I am born again, I want to be a tree.
